KTM's electric bikes
KTM UK has recently held days at the dedicated electric bikes-only E-Scape facility near Warrington for both dealers and media to experience the electric Freeride E models.

“KTM is a company of motorcycle riders and the best way to get our dealers excited about a new product is to get them on the saddle,” said KTM spokesman Luke Brackenbury. “We do this for all new bikes, but the electric bikes are something very different for the brand. For the dealers, they are naturally curious and for them to sell the bikes requires activity different to conventional combustion engine bikes, such as the training programmes for technical staff. Dynamic events are a great way to introduce new models.

“For the media, there’s a great deal of interest in electric propulsion so we are trying to satisfy their curiosity by allowing them to get on these bikes in the envirnoments they were intended for.

“The world launch of the street legal E-SM supermoto happened recently in Barcelona and the UK will follow up with some national events and other activities. KTM is taking e-propulsion very seriously.”

Brackenbury continued: “As the leading manufacturer in off-road motorcycles, it was important for KTM to bring to market an electric bike that would set a new standard. With the Freeride E, we want to demonstrate that off-road riding will still be accessible in the future and, with its ease of riding, to introduce a new generation of riders to bikes without their fear of noise, hot exhausts and working clutches and gearboxes.”
